Beim Arbeiten mit Gnome-Terminal stelle ich fest, dass ich häufig eine zweite Kopie einer Registerkarte öffnen möchte: Beispielsweise benötige ich während einer SSH-Sitzung möglicherweise eine zweite Sitzung auf demselben Host und demselben Remote-Pfad; oder eine zweite, mc
wenn zwei Bedienfelder nicht ausreichen. Ist das möglich?
Antwort1
Sie können nicht den gesamten Status einer Registerkarte duplizieren. Dazu müssten Sie irgendwie einen ganzen Prozessbaum kopieren, was (falls überhaupt möglich) schwarze Magie ist (und nicht einmal mit Netzwerkverbindungen funktionieren würde).
Der Grund dafür ist, dass ein Terminalprogramm nur weiß, welche Prozesse unter ihm laufen, nicht aber deren Interna und insbesondere nicht den Zustand vonFernbedienungProzesse. Siekönntessh user@host
Lassen Sie es mit den gleichen Argumenten wie das aktuell ausgeführte starten ssh
, Sie können es jedoch nicht zum gleichen Remote-Pfad zwingen.*
*
Ich mache manchmal Folgendes: (Verbindung A) pwd > ~/foo;
(Verbindung B)cd $(< ~/foo)